The Vibe Coder vs The Senior Dev
Автор: smashplus
Загружено: 2026-01-19
Просмотров: 3
Vibe Coding" as a Shift in Abstraction
The sources define this shift through the term "Vibe Coding," a concept attributed to Andrej Karpathy, which suggests developers should "fully give into the vibes, embrace exponentials, and forget that the code even exists",. In this context, English (or natural language) becomes the new programming language,.
This conceptual shift relies on the distinction between coding and programming:
• Coding is defined as the manual translation of logic into machine instructions (syntax), a skill that AI models can now perform faster than humans.
• Programming is viewed as a broader, creative art requiring ingenuity and instincts to solve problems.
• Consequently, the focus shifts entirely to the "what"—the vision and the product—while the AI handles the "how"—the implementation details and boilerplate,.
The New Role: Product Manager and Orchestrator
As the focus moves away from writing lines of code, the developer’s role evolves into that of a Product Manager or a high-level orchestrator.
• Delegation and Clarity: Success in this model depends on "clarity"—the ability to clearly describe what needs to be built—and "orchestration," the ability to break work into chunks an agent can handle,. Senior engineers are often more successful with these tools not because they code faster, but because they provide "higher signal prompts" with "tighter specs" and less ambiguity.
• The "Linus Torvalds" Model: The sources draw a parallel to Linus Torvalds, who rarely writes code for the Linux kernel anymore but acts as a "vibe coder" by reviewing, filtering, and orchestrating contributions via email. Similarly, developers now treat AI agents as interns or junior coworkers, reviewing their output rather than doing the manual labor themselves,.
#vibecoding #debate #technology #java
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: